Transaction e317e4a7598b86b83374ffc50f6ff750d688554b2946bb144249081c92b771bf
1 Input
2 Outputs
- e317e4a7598b86b83374ffc50f6ff750d688554b2946bb144249081c92b771bf:0
- e317e4a7598b86b83374ffc50f6ff750d688554b2946bb144249081c92b771bf:1
value 31300000
address 18kmgkmaAeSzYy18H5KgnNZxsV4bk5Rk3C
value 148699322
address 139FVDNts6bwzPK5tvFvSzYGeKxQzzH6n6